Preliminary card (Fuel TV)

Chris Camozzi vs. Dustin Jacoby - This one is probably a "loser gets cut" fight. Camozzi, a TUF 11 contestant, was already cut before after a loss to TUF 11 alumn Kyle Noke. He got brought back at UFC 137 and lost his fight against Francis Carmont. He gets to fight Jacoby, who lost his UFC debut also at UFC 137. A 0-2 skid in a division like MW doesn't bode well for their future so I hope they put on a good fight.

Joey Beltran vs. Lavar Johnson - "Big" Johnson is another Strikeforce HW that has been brought into the UFC. Make no mistake, he sucks. He has a big right hand, bad cardio and no ground game. Luckily for him, they give him an opponent that also likes to brawl, giving him a decent chance of getting the W. Beltran is 1-3 in his last 4 and really needs a win. Now that the UFC is bringing over the Strikeforce roster, HW can't just hang around with losing records. He has the skillset to win this fight but hey, it's at HW, anything can happen.

Michael Johnson vs. Shane Roller - Michael Johnson is a pretty 1-dimensional wrestler with bad striking that, despite being a wrestler, can't hold people down. Shane Roller has a pretty good submission. I think it's pretty obvious how this will play out if Roller is smart about his gameplan.

Charles Oliveira vs. Eric Wisely - Oliveira needs a win, badly. He's 2-2 with 1 NC in the UFC and the momentum he got from his first 2 fights has fizzled out a bit. He's moving to FW to give himself a boost. I hope he can get himself back on the winning side of things because he showed potential. If he loses this, he's officialy a dud. Wisely is making his UFC debut, can Oliveira capitalize?

Cub Swanson vs. George Roop - Roop will look to rebound from his loss to Hioki against fellow WEC product Cub Swanson. Both guys are pretty good FW but I give the edge to Roop, his striking being the main factor. Should be a great fight.

Johnny Bedford vs. Mitch Gagnon - The UFC is really pushing Bedford. Is it because he looks like recently dethroned Jon Fitch? He's pretty big for a BW. Combine that with wrestling skill and he's a tough test for any low tier fighter in the division.

Mike Russow vs. John-Olav Einemo - Einemo, despite being a world class grappler, was outgrappled by Dave Herman and pounded out. Russow hits like a ton of bricks and since he's from DeathClutch, you can be sure he has a good amount of wrestling training. Unless Einemo has shored up his striking (not likely, a Maia style transformation isn't that easy), he's probably getting KO'ed for his troubles.

Evan Dunham vs. Nik Lentz - Lentz is BORING. He's one-dimensional smother monster of was outsmothered by Mark Bocek and complained about the decision. The UFC is probably trying to get him on a losing streak so that they can cut him. Why is this fight the closest one to the Main card, I will never get since it's 80% likely it will go to a decision.

Main card

Demian Maia vs. Chris Weidman - Maia has showed great improvement with his striking in recent fights. That was going to get put to the test against Bisping but things have changed. Maia will now faced surging prospect Chris Weidman, who has a very good wrestling background. Seeing how Maia's grappling is clearly superior to his, it would be wise for him to keep it standing or use a powerful top control game instead of trying for submissions. He's coming in on short notice to face a Top 10 MW so he better have a very good gameplan. Should Maia win, a Maia-Mu?oz for the next title shot at Sonnen wouldn't be farfetched.

Michael Bisping vs. Chael Sonnen - Bisping finally gets a chance to fight for the MW title, something most people would only have dreamed of when the UFC ran out of MW opponents. I don't know why, seeing how he is legitimately a Top 10 MW. Now the only problem is that he's facing Chael for the title shot so... yeah, Bisping will only fight for the title when the UFC runs out of MW opponents. I shouldn't "count" Bisping out entirely (see what I did there?) but Chael is the #2 MW and he's the only guy in recent years to make Silva sweat. Bisping was gassing from punching Miller in the face without opposition and we all know how the UK fighters have troubles with wrestlers. Chael surely knows this and will exploit it as much as he can. Also, Bisping has no chance in hell to beat Anderson Silva while Sonnen vs Silva II would sell PPV like it was the cure for cancer.

Rashad Evans vs. Phil Davis - I don't even know. Is this for a LHW title shot? Will Henderson leapfrog Evans? Will Davis be required to fight someone else before he gets a shot? I don't see either guy beating Bones but at least Evans would make the fight competitive. Davis gets thrown into the deep end against Evans, a guy who his extremely well rounded and doesn't have any glaring holes in his game. Will Davis be able to win on physicality alone? Evans showed no signs of ring rust and dispatched Tito Ortiz with ease. Davis struggled a bit to beat Ant?nio Rog?rio Nogueira. He still needed time to develop but this was the fight he was booked for so let's see if he can make something out of it.
